CrawlJobs Logo

Embedded Software V&V Engineer

United Kingdom, Bristol 60.00 - 70.00 GBP / Hour · Job Posted January 15, 2026
Apply Position
Job Link Share

Job Description

The team creates complex, highly reliable real-time software that powers missile systems and their components, ensuring that they provide the performance and functionality users require when they need it. Involved all the way through development – from concept studies through trials firings and the move into production and service.

Job Responsibility

  • Verification and validation activities on real-time systems application software for the next generation of Missile Systems
  • Taking requirements, developing them into robust test cases, preparing and executing tests, capturing data, and delivering actionable feedback to project teams

Requirements

  • Strong experience of V&V activities in an embedded software environment
  • Strong problem-solving skills
  • Ability to work independently or as part of a team
  • Good communication skills
  • Good documentation skills
  • Ability to turn requirements into structured test cases and procedures
  • Experience of working in a lab environment on an electro mechanical product running embedded software
  • Good working knowledge of the complete software engineering lifecycle
  • Scripting abilities
  • Embedded software development experience using Ada and/or C/C++

Nice to have

  • Safety critical systems
  • Knowledge of standards such as DefStan 00-55, DO-178C & DO-330
  • Knowledge of Real Time Operating Systems
  • Model Driven Design
  • Knowledge of test automation methods
  • Knowledge of DOORS, Engineering Workflow Management (EWM), Rapita Suite, Rhapsody, LDRA
  • Breakpoint Analysis
  • Experience of Focused Code Reviews

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Embedded Software V&V Engineer

8 matching positions

Embedded Software V&V Engineer

Join a growing V&V team supporting multiple cutting-edge defence programmes. You...
Location
Location
United Kingdom , Stevenage
Salary
Salary:
55000.00 - 64000.00 GBP / Year
thepeoplenetwork.co.uk Logo
Fynity
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ong V&V experience in an embedded software environment
  • Ability to turn requirements into robust test cases
  • Hands-on experience with electro-mechanical embedded systems
  • Good understanding of the software engineering lifecycle
  • Python scripting skills
  • C code-level understanding (highly desirable)
  • Ada a bonus
Job Responsibility
Job Responsibility
  • Create structured test cases from requirements
  • Execute and document V&V test campaigns
  • Analyse results and provide clear feedback
  • Assess requirement testability and coverage
  • Carry out timing tests, code-path analysis & focused code reviews
  • Work in small V&V teams (2–3) embedded within larger engineering groups
  • Use lab equipment including scopes, COTS tools, Rapita, LDRA & in-house test rigs
  • Work with embedded platforms, RTOS and safety-critical systems
  • Use Python and proprietary tools for scripting, data injection & analysis
What we offer
What we offer
  • Varied, meaningful work across multiple product lines
  • Major exposure to real engineering challenges
  • Strong training, development & career progression
  • Collaborative environment with real influence on design
  • Direct contribution to next-generation defence systems
  • Fulltime
Read More
Arrow Right

Embedded Software V&V Engineer

The team creates complex, highly reliable real-time software that powers missile...
Location
Location
United Kingdom , Stevenage
Salary
Salary:
60.00 - 70.00 GBP / Hour
morson.com Logo
Morson Talent
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ong experience of V&V activities in an embedded software environment
  • Strong problem-solving skills
  • Ability to work independently or as part of a team
  • Good communication skills
  • Good documentation skills
  • Ability to turn requirements into structured test cases and procedures
  • Experience of working in a lab environment on an electro mechanical product running embedded software
  • Good working knowledge of the complete software engineering lifecycle
  • Scripting abilities
  • Embedded software development experience using Ada and/or C/C++
Job Responsibility
Job Responsibility
  • You will be responsible for the verification and validation activities on real-time systems application software for the next generation of Missile Systems
  • The role requires taking requirements, developing them into robust test cases, preparing and executing tests, capturing data, and delivering actionable feedback to project teams
  • You will have to draw upon your strong practical problem-solving skills, data acquisition expertise, and adaptability
Read More
Arrow Right

Embedded Software Engineer - DO-178

As a Embedded Software Engineer - DO-178, you will contribute to the development...
Location
Location
United States , Sugar Grove
Salary
Salary:
Not provided
https://www.soprasteria.com Logo
Sopra Steria
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's or Master's degree in Computer Engineering, Software Engineering, or Aerospace Engineering
  • Mid-level to senior experience in DO-178 V&V, with a strong focus on testing on target
  • Experience in embedded software development
  • Good understanding of DO-178C software lifecycle processes
  • Experience with C or C++ programming
  • Knowledge of software verification activities (unit testing, integration testing, structural coverage)
  • Strong communication skills and ability to work autonomously in a collaborative engineering environment
Job Responsibility
Job Responsibility
  • Engage directly with customers to resolve technical or logistical issues
  • Independently execute according to project plans
  • Collaboratively work with other software and test engineers throughout verification phases of the product development lifecycle
  • Perform software verification and validation activities (reviews, unit testing, integration testing, and testing on target hardware)
  • Participate in technical reviews and audits
  • Collaborate with multidisciplinary teams (systems, hardware, quality, safety)
  • Work independently with minimal supervision and drive tasks to completion
What we offer
What we offer
  • All members included in annual cash bonus opportunity
  • 2% annual retirement benefit opportunity
  • Training/Professional Development opportunities for all members
  • 6 paid holidays
  • Industry leading medical, dental, and vision Insurance
  • Vacation / Sick Time / Bereavement leave
  • Employee Assistance Program, including mental health benefits
  • Spouse / Child Optional Life
  • Whole Life Insurance / Critical Illness Insurance / Legal Assistance / Military Leave
  • Fulltime
Read More
Arrow Right

Senior Embedded Software Engineer

Silvus is seeking a full-time Senior Embedded Software Engineer to join our Engi...
Location
Location
United States , Irvine
Salary
Salary:
135000.00 - 240000.00 USD / Year
silvustechnologies.com Logo
Silvus Technologies (International)
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um Bachelor of Science degree in Electrical Engineering, Computer Science, or relevant engineering fields
  • 5+ years of relevant embedded system software development experience
  • Expertise in C programming and experience in Linux kernel driver development
Job Responsibility
Job Responsibility
  • Implementation of software portion of MAC (Medium Access Control) and mobile ad-hoc networking routing protocols
  • Network management software and web interface implementation
  • Implementation of different security protocols and encryption algorithms
  • Audio streaming and push-to-talk voice application implementation
  • Analyze and improve product security and robustness to meet certain regulatory requirements such as NIST FIPS 140-3 and NIAP Common Criteria
  • Implementation of testing software for product performance and reliability testing
  • Device driver and board support package development and maintenance for both ARM and RISC-V based systems
  • Linux system customization and scripting
What we offer
What we offer
  • Reasonable accommodation for individuals with disabilities
  • Fulltime
Read More
Arrow Right

Principal Embedded Software Engineer

Silvus is seeking a full-time Principal Embedded Software Engineer to join our E...
Location
Location
United States , Los Angeles
Salary
Salary:
165000.00 - 215000.00 USD / Year
silvustechnologies.com Logo
Silvus Technologies (International)
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or of Science degree in Electrical Engineering, Computer Science, or relevant engineering fields
  • 8+ years of relevant embedded system software development experience
  • Expertise in C programming and experience in Linux kernel driver development
Job Responsibility
Job Responsibility
  • Implementation of the software portion of MAC (Medium Access Control) and mobile ad-hoc networking routing protocols
  • Network management software and web interface implementation
  • Implementation of different security protocols and encryption algorithms
  • Audio streaming and push-to-talk voice application implementation
  • Analyzing and improving product security and robustness to meet certain regulatory requirements such as NIST FIPS 140-3 and NIAP Common Criteria
  • Implementation of testing software for product performance and reliability testing
  • Device driver and board support package development and maintenance for both ARM and RISC-V based systems
  • Linux system customization and scripting
  • Fulltime
Read More
Arrow Right

Senior Embedded Software Engineer

Silvus is seeking a Senior Embedded Software Engineer to join our Engineering Gr...
Location
Location
United States , Irvine
Salary
Salary:
135000.00 - 200000.00 USD / Year
silvustechnologies.com Logo
Silvus Technologies (International)
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or of Science degree in Electrical Engineering, Computer Science, or related fields
  • Minimum 5 years of relevant embedded system software development experience
  • Expertise in C programming and experience in Linux kernel driver development
  • Must be a U.S. Citizen due to clients under U.S. government contracts
  • All employment is contingent upon the successful clearance of a background check
Job Responsibility
Job Responsibility
  • Implementation of software portion of MAC (Medium Access Control) and mobile ad-hoc networking routing protocols
  • Network management software and web interface implementation
  • Implementation of different security protocols and encryption algorithms
  • Audio streaming and push to talk voice application implementation
  • Analyze and improve product security and robustness to meet certain regulatory requirements such as NIST FIPS 140-3 and NIAP Common Criteria
  • Implementation of testing software for product performance and reliability testing
  • Device driver and board support package development and maintenance for both ARM and RISC-V based systems
  • Linux system customization and scripting
  • Fulltime
Read More
Arrow Right

Senior Embedded Software Engineer

Silvus is seeking a full-time Senior Embedded Software Engineer to join our Rese...
Location
Location
United States , Los Angeles
Salary
Salary:
140000.00 - 200000.00 USD / Year
silvustechnologies.com Logo
Silvus Technologies (International)
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um Bachelor of Science degree in Electrical, Computer, or Communications Engineering, Computer Science, or relevant engineering fields
  • Minimum 5 years of relevant embedded system software development experience
  • 3 years of relevant embedded system software development experience with an advanced STEM degree
  • Expertise in C programming and experience in Linux kernel driver development
Job Responsibility
Job Responsibility
  • Implementation of software portion of MAC (Medium Access Control) and mobile ad-hoc networking routing protocols
  • Network management software and web interface implementation
  • Implementation of different security protocols and encryption algorithms
  • Audio streaming and push-to-talk voice application implementation
  • Analyze and improve product security and robustness to meet certain regulatory requirements such as NIST FIPS 140-3 and NIAP Common Criteria
  • Implementation of testing software for product performance and reliability testing
  • Device driver and board support package development and maintenance for both ARM and RISC-V based systems
  • Linux system customization and scripting
  • Fulltime
Read More
Arrow Right

Senior Embedded Software Engineer

Silvus is recruiting a Senior Embedded Software Engineer reporting to the Direct...
Location
Location
United States , Los Angeles
Salary
Salary:
135000.00 - 200000.00 USD / Year
silvustechnologies.com Logo
Silvus Technologies (International)
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or of Science degree in Electrical Engineering, Computer Science, or related fields
  • Minimum 5 years of relevant embedded system software development experience
  • Expertise in C programming and experience in Linux kernel driver development
  • Must be a U.S. Citizen due to clients under U.S. government contracts
  • All employment is contingent upon the successful clearance of a background check
Job Responsibility
Job Responsibility
  • Implementation of software portion of MAC (Medium Access Control) and mobile ad-hoc networking routing protocols
  • Network management software and web interface implementation
  • Implementation of different security protocols and encryption algorithms
  • Audio streaming and push to talk voice application implementation
  • Analyze and improve product security and robustness to meet certain regulatory requirements such as NIST FIPS 140-3 and NIAP Common Criteria
  • Implementation of testing software for product performance and reliability testing
  • Device driver and board support package development and maintenance for both ARM and RISC-V based systems
  • Linux system customization and scripting
  • Fulltime
Read More
Arrow Right